What Are Window Films and How Do They Improve Energy Efficiency?

Window films are thin polyester-based layers installed on the interior surface of glass. Once applied, the film changes how the window handles solar heat, glare, and UV radiation. The window frame stays the same. The glass stays the same. Only the thermal and light performance changes.

In Toronto homes, windows are often the weakest point in the building envelope. In summer, direct sunlight creates solar heat gain. Rooms warm up fast. Air conditioners run longer. In winter, glass loses heat quickly, especially older double-pane units. Cold air pools near the window.

Window films help by:

  • Reflecting part of the sun’s infrared heat
  • Reducing glare without blocking all natural light
  • Blocking up to 99% of UV rays
  • Reducing heat transfer through glass

That last point is key for energy savings. By slowing heat transfer, window films reduce the workload on HVAC systems. Less strain on AC in summer. Less heat loss in winter.

Why Window Films Make Sense in Toronto’s Climate

Toronto weather is not mild. Summers bring intense afternoon sun, especially on west-facing windows in areas like Etobicoke, Vaughan, and Mississauga. Winters bring long heating seasons and freezing temperatures. That mix creates constant expansion and contraction at the glass surface.

Window films help stabilize that performance.

In summer, they reduce solar heat gain coefficient (SHGC). In plain words, less sun heat enters the room. That means:

  • Lower peak indoor temperatures
  • Shorter AC cycles
  • Less temperature difference between rooms

In winter, films reduce radiant heat loss through the glass. The window surface feels less cold. Seating areas near windows become usable again.

Many GTA homeowners report that after installing window films, they adjust blinds less often and change the thermostat less frequently. Those small behaviour shifts add up.

Installation Quality and Long-Term Performance

Window films must be installed correctly to perform well long term. Poor installation can lead to bubbling, peeling, or early failure.

A professional install includes:

  • Thorough glass cleaning
  • Precise measurement and trimming
  • Even pressure application
  • Edge sealing where required

DIY kits may look simple, but dust or moisture can reduce performance. Professional-grade materials and experience matter.

The concept of frosted glass dates back centuries, originally achieved through the labor-intensive process of acid etching or sandblasting. These methods, while effective, were costly and permanent. The demand for a more flexible and affordable solution led to the development of frosted window film in the late 20th century. This innovation allowed homeowners and designers to achieve the same elegant look without the permanence or expense of traditional methods.

Early Developments

Initially, frosted window films were simple, offering basic privacy and light diffusion. However, advancements in technology soon expanded their capabilities. Today, frosted films are available in a wide range of patterns, textures, and colors, providing endless possibilities for creativity and design.

Solar window film is a thin layer of polyester or other materials that is applied to the interior or exterior of glass surfaces in homes, offices, or vehicles. It is designed to reduce heat, glare, and UV rays while providing privacy and enhancing the aesthetics of your space.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, window films can significantly improve insulation performance and reduce energy loss.

Types of Solar Window Films

There are several types of solar window films to consider:

  • Reflective Films: These films are designed to reflect sunlight and reduce heat gain, making them ideal for hot climates.
  • Tinted Films: Tinted films offer a range of shades to reduce glare while maintaining a level of privacy.
  • Low-E Films: Also known as low-emissivity films, these are perfect for insulating windows, keeping heat in during the winter and out during the summer.

Understanding Mirror Window Film

Mirror window film, often referred to as privacy window film or window privacy film, is a thin laminate film that can be installed on the interior or exterior of glass surfaces in homes and buildings. The film creates a mirrored effect on the outside while maintaining a clear view from the inside during the day. This unique characteristic provides homeowners with the privacy they need without sacrificing natural light.
